Guatemala is a country in Central America, bordered by Mexico to the north and west, Belize and Honduras to the east, and El Salvador to the southeast. Guatemala is a popular tourist destination due to its natural beauty and rich culture.
Guatemala has many places worth visiting such as Tikal National Park, Semuc Champey Natural Monument, Lago de Atitlan or Antigua Guatemala. The best time of year to visit Guatemala is from November to April when it’s dry season.

Visa Free

No visa is required to enter this country

As the name elaborates, you don't need any visa to enter this country.
The purpose of the whole concept is to enable an individual to enter a particular country without obtaining any visa in advance or at arrival.
Nonetheless, this doesn't apply to every country. Instead, your country has to sign an agreement with any other country to allow you and all other citizens to travel without any visa. For instance, you are a resident of one particular country named X, and your government has signed an agreement with another country: Y. So, now you can travel to this country with a free visa. You just would need a valid passport & your bags.
Nonetheless, note that you can’t stay in a Visa-free country for an unlimited period. Instead, the total duration for an individual to stay in a visa-free country varies.
So, Please check with the embassy of the country before you travel.
